Chyna apparently was planning to go to rehab shortly before she died.
Audio of the final voicemail Chyna left was released by People Magazine on Thursday -- also the day signifiying the one-year anniversary of her death. The former wrestling star died on April 20, 2016, after overdosing on a combination of alcohol and prescription drugs.
Chyna was leaving the voicemail for Erik Angra, a documentary filmaker.
?I am doing much better," Chyna said in the message. "It's a beautiful day outside. All the sailboats are out today, it?s a beautiful day.?
Chyna went on to note her plans to check into a rehab center, located in Malibu, CA.
?I go for two weeks and drink cucumber juice and whatever, and swim around ? I can get a therapy doggy the right way,? she said, also inquiring as to the health of Angra, noting, ?I want to make sure you?re okay, and I?m here.?
Angra has made a documentary about Chyna. Entitled "Wrestling with Chyna", it is set for release this fall.
Chyna was part of the original incarnation of D-Generation X, along with Shawn Michaels and Triple H. She went on to hold both the WWF Women's Title and the Intercontinental Title, while also competing in "all-male" events such as the Royal Rumble and King of the Ring tournament.
